近期公司需要做一个比较冷门的项目,对于上位机开发者来说可能很常见,但是对不接触上位机开发方面的小白来说,还是比较棘手,一头雾水,今天花费了一天时间,把句柄、user32、窗口等定义了解了一下,并结合项目的实际需求,看看Win API提供了哪些需要的可用的方法。
句柄
百度AI中对句柄的解释,我觉得比较通俗易懂。
”“句柄是一种用于引用对象或资源的特殊数据类型。 句柄可以看作是一个指向对象或资源的标识符,而不是直接引用对象或资源本身。句柄机制在C#中用于管理资源、跟踪对象的生命周期以及实现对象之间的引用关系”
如果想要对句柄进行更深层次的了解,可以百度一下,网上大佬很多。
user32
User32.dll是C#中常用的DLL,用于各种与用户界面和窗口相关的操作。
- 窗口操作:User32.dll提供了操作窗口的函数,如创建、关闭、调整大小、移动和隐藏/显示窗口。
- 消息处理:User32.dll允许您处理发送到窗口的消息。
- 输入控制:User32.dll提供了处理键盘和鼠标

最低0.47元/天 解锁文章
925

被折叠的 条评论
为什么被折叠?



